Meet Bob & Alice: Two Leaders, One Reality
At the heart of The Gravity of Command are Bob and Alice—two leadership archetypes that represent the real tensions modern leaders face. They are not fictional caricatures. They are patterns—drawn from real organizations, real teams, and real decisions.
Bob — The Purpose-Driven Veteran: Bob represents the experienced leader who has built teams, delivered programs, and earned trust through consistency, judgment, and human connection. He understands how to motivate people, navigate stakeholders, and lead under pressure. But Bob now faces a new challenge: an environment where AI moves faster than experience alone, and decisions are increasingly shaped by data, automation, and intelligent systems. Bob’s journey is about evolving without losing what made him effective—purpose, empathy, and accountability.
Alice — The AI-Native Leader: Alice represents the new generation of leaders who are fluent in data, algorithms, and automation. She excels at leveraging AI and analytics, optimizing systems, and moving at digital speed. Yet Alice faces her own challenge: learning how to anchor fast-moving technology to vision, ethics, and human trust. Alice’s journey is about discovering that leadership gravity is not created by intelligence alone—but by purpose, judgment, and responsibility.
Why Bob & Alice Matter: Together, Bob and Alice illustrate the central truth of the book: The future of leadership does not belong to one generation or skill set. It belongs to leaders who can combine human gravity with intelligent systems. Readers may see themselves in Bob, Alice—or somewhere in between.
